ARCB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review
158 of the 4,012 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ArcBest (ARCB)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$769M — up 71% from $451M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 30 funds opened new ARCB positions and 13 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 64 added to existing stakes and 43 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$18.3M. The largest seller was LSV Asset Management, cutting an estimated $5.56M.
